#102676 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#102676 is composed of 6.3% red, 14.9%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.4% cyan, 67.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 227.1 degrees, a saturation of 76.1% and a lightness of 26.3%. #102676 color hex could be obtained by blending #204cec with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#102676

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02050e is the darkest color, while #fcf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#102676

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e4048 is the less saturated color, while #011d85 is the most saturated one.
